Output 307cbe7394ee40baa732da4e1b2d18d750aad9e2e96bcb12a8a564a04414196f:10

value
651700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bf9402f29cda08f6614475d42bb4e82caa036e OP_EQUAL
address
383p3s6yZWCJVTZ5R8XpUzMJLLUzCeCg5a
transaction
307cbe7394ee40baa732da4e1b2d18d750aad9e2e96bcb12a8a564a04414196f
confirmations
7467
spent
true